Abstract
The infrared emission spectra and decay lifetimes of Tm3+-doped and Tm3+-Ho3+, Tm3+-Yb3+co-doped tellurite fibres were measured using 808 nm and 978 nm diode laser pump sources in the range 1.35 μm to 2.2 μm. The spectra were compared with varying fibre lengths and core diameters. Tm3+-doped fibre shows strong emission at ∼1.8 μm and when co-doped with Ho3+, energy transfer results in strong Ho3+fluorescence at ∼2.0 μm. These fibres show promise for compact mid-IR fibre laser sources.
